The video explores the fascinating history and evolution of toothpaste, from ancient Egyptian formulas to modern-day products. It highlights the discovery of fluoride's dental benefits and the ingredients used in contemporary toothpaste. Additionally, it provides a simple recipe for making homemade toothpaste and tests its effectiveness.
